site stats

C# xml デシリアライズ qiita

WebApr 6, 2024 · この記事では、C# および Visual Basic で XmlSerializer を使用してシリアル化と逆シリアル化を行う例を示します。 例: XElement オブジェクトを含むオブジェク … WebMar 3, 2009 · XmlSerializerを使用してxmlをListにデシリアライズできますか? その場合、どのタイプの追加属性を使用する必要がありますか、または XmlSerializer インスタンスを構築するためにどの追加パラメーターを使用する必要がありますか?

第14回 オブジェクトをXMLでシリアライズ(6) - @IT

WebSep 16, 2024 · C# で XML ⇔ カスタムモデル のシリアライズ・デシリアライズ sell XML, C#, XDocument C# と .NET Core のお話です。 仕事で XML で書かれたファイルを扱う … WebApr 4, 2024 · Simple Case. Once we have the classes and the XML data set properly, the deserialize function is really simple. In the list we have 2 books now. 1 var serializer = … most prepared award https://thetoonz.net

C# で XML をオブジェクトにデシリアライズする Delft スタック

WebImports Newtonsoft.Json Public Class Form1 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click ''変換元データセットを初期化 Dim srcds As New DataSet1 For i As Integer = 1 To 5 Dim row As DataSet1.DataTable1Row = srcds.DataTable1.NewDataTable1Row row.DataColumn1 = i.ToString row.DataColumn2 … WebMay 26, 2015 · 上記の方法を利用する場合は、プロジェクトの参照設定に「System.Runtime.Serialization.dll」を追加して、シリアライズするクラスに [DataContract]属性を、フィールドに [DataMember]属性をそれぞれ記述する必要があります。. 以下、xmlをシリアル化して直接編集して ... WebApr 19, 2024 · 本稿では、XmlSerializerクラスを使ったシリアライズ/デシリアライズの方法と注意点を解説する。 なお、XmlSerializerクラスは.NET Frameworkのバージョ … minilite racing wheels

【C#】XMLファイルを入力・出力する方法を解説 – 凡人プログ …

Category:C#でXMLをシリアライズする方法をわかりやすく解説! .NETコラム

Tags:C# xml デシリアライズ qiita

C# xml デシリアライズ qiita

C#でXMLをシリアライズする方法をわかりやすく解説! .NETコラム

WebAug 20, 2024 · c#におけるxmlのシリアライズ・デシリアライズとは? 現在のソフトウェア開発において、XMLファイルは多くのシステムで使用されています。 XMLファイルを作成することをシリアライズ、XMLファイルを読み込むことをデシリアライズと言います。 WebJun 6, 2024 · Yamlファイルを出力(シリアライズ). まずは出力先のフォルダです。. 私は今回、 C\DQ\ フォルダを作成し、そこに出力していきます。. 自分の中の勝手な風習として先に読み込みたいんですけど、先にファイル用意したほうが手打ちより楽そうなのでこっち ...

C# xml デシリアライズ qiita

Did you know?

WebMay 28, 2024 · 以下は、 XML を C# クラスに自動的に逆シリアル化するための手順です。 検索バーに 開発者コマンドプロンプト と入力し、クリックして開きます。 cd C:\X と … Webそもそも、UnityとC#の環境下でXMLをデシリアライズする手段は何通りか用意されています。. System.Xml.Serialization.XmlSerializer. System.Xml.XmlDocument. …

WebXMLデータをデシリアライズする場合、作成するクラスやプロパティに、XMLのタグやXML属性を対応付けしなければなりません 具体的には、クラスやプロパティに”属性”を与えることになります 与えられる属性としては、代表的なものとして以下があります クラス設計 XML “person” の構造は以下の様になっています ルートタグは “person” “job”タグ … WebDeserialization of Complex XML to Object C#. In this example, we will check how we can deserialize complete XML files into C# objects. When we say complex XML it is XMLs …

Web例えば、Newtonsoft.Jsonでは、JSONのnameというキーがあったとき、これはC#のNameプロパティにデシリアライズできる。 System.Text.Jsonではデフォルトではこれはできない。 でも、JSONのキーはキャメルケースにしたいじゃん? めんどくさい方法

WebApr 6, 2024 · 転送形式を決定したら、必要に応じて Serialize メソッドまたは Deserialize メソッドを呼び出すことができます。 オブジェクトを逆シリアル化するには 逆シリアル化するオブジェクトの型を使用して、 XmlSerializer を構築します。 Deserialize メソッドを呼び出して、オブジェクトのレプリカを生成します。 逆シリアル化を行う際には、次の …

Webデシリアライズ デシリアライズには Deserialize メソッドを使用します。 string path = "test.xml"; SimpleClass sc; using (StreamReader sr = new StreamReader (path)) { XmlSerializer xs = new XmlSerializer (typeof (SimpleClass)); sc = (SimpleClass)xs.Deserialize (sr); } Console.WriteLine (" {0} {1}", sc.Num, sc.Str); 123 abc … most pre ordered kpop album in 24 hoursWebMay 28, 2024 · 以下は、 XML を C# クラスに自動的に逆シリアル化するための手順です。 検索バーに 開発者コマンドプロンプト と入力し、クリックして開きます。 cd C:\X と入力して、 XML ファイルパスに移動します。 XML ファイルの行番号と不要な文字を削除します。 xsd test.XML と入力して、test.XML から同等の XSD ファイル を作成します。 … mini listerine mouthwashWebMay 25, 2024 · デシリアライズしたいのですが、 System.Xml.Serialization.XmlSerializer.Deserialize (StreamReader) をコールすると一つ目のXMLをデシリアライズする際に以下のExceptionとなってしまいます。 [System.InvalidOperationException] = {" は指定できません。 "} 1つ … minilite replica wheelsWebデシリアライズさせるためのクラスを定義する。 まずは会社名 (company)だけをやってみる。 【CompanyInfo.cs】 using System.Runtime.Serialization; namespace … most preschoolers can produceWebApr 18, 2024 · XMLファイルの入出力を行う方法として、今回は下記3つの方法を使用したXMLファイルの入出力について解説します。 System.Xml.Serialization.XmlSerializer System.Xml.XmlTextWriter/System.Xml.XmlTextReader System.Xml.Linq.XElement System.Xml.Serialization.XmlSerializer namespaceにusing System.Xml.Serializationが … minilist things to draw with penWebApr 6, 2024 · この記事では、C# および Visual Basic で XmlSerializer を使用してシリアル化と逆シリアル化を行う例を示します。 例: XElement オブジェクトを含むオブジェクトを作成し、それらをシリアル化および逆シリアル化する 次の例では、 XElement オブジェクトを含んでいる多数のオブジェクトを作成します。 次に、それらのオブジェクトをメ … mini lite rv by rockwoodWebMay 22, 2024 · シリアライザというのは、c#内の「オブジェクト」とc#外の「xml」を一対一に対応させるためのものです。 なので、マッピング先のクラスの構造が異なっていれば当然デシリアライズ操作は失敗します。 most preschool teachers prefer round tables